WebbThe Small Claims Court in Texas is created under Chapter 28 of the Texas Government Code. It has concurrent jurisdiction with the Justice Court in actions by any person for the recovery of money in which the amount involved, exclusive of costs, does not exceed $20,000.00. WebbA small claims case is a lawsuit brought for the recovery of money damages, civil penalties, personal property, or other relief allowed by law. The claim can be for no more than $20,000 excluding statutory interest and court costs but including attorney fees, if any. Governed by Rules 500 - 507 of Part V of the Rules of Civil Procedure. SMALL CLAIMS are presided over by the Justice of the Peace. The amount in controversy may not exceed $20,000 excluding statutory interest and court costs BUT including attorney fees, if any.
